require_relative '../websocket'

require 'uri/ws'
require 'uri/wss'

module Ronin
  module Support
    module Web
      module WebSocket
        #
        # Adds helper methods for working with WebSockets.
        #
        module Mixin
          # @!macro [new] ssl_kwargs
          #   @option ssl [1, 1.1, 1.2, String, Symbol, nil] :version
          #     The SSL version to use.
          #
          #   @option ssl [Symbol, Boolean] :verify
          #     Specifies whether to verify the SSL certificate.
          #     May be one of the following:
          #
          #     * `:none`
          #     * `:peer`
          #     * `:fail_if_no_peer_cert`
          #     * `:client_once`
          #
          #   @option ssl [Crypto::Key::RSA, OpenSSL::PKey::RSA, nil] :key
          #     The RSA key to use for the SSL context.
          #
          #   @option ssl [String] :key_file
          #     The path to the SSL `.key` file.
          #
          #   @option ssl [Crypto::Cert, OpenSSL::X509::Certificate, nil] :cert
          #     The X509 certificate to use for the SSL context.
          #
          #   @option ssl [String] :cert_file
          #     The path to the SSL `.crt` file.
          #
          #   @option ssl [String] :ca_bundle
          #     Path to the CA certificate file or directory.

          # @!macro [new] client_kwargs
          #   @option kwargs [String, nil] :bind_host
          #     The optional host to bind the server socket to.
          #
          #   @option kwargs [Integer, nil] :bind_port
          #     The optioanl port to bind the server socket to. If not
          #     specified, it will default to the port of the URL.
          #
          #   @!macro ssl_kwargs

          #
          # Tests whether the WebSocket is open.
          #
          # @param [String, URI::WS, URI::WSS] url
          #   The `ws://` or `wss://` URL to connect to.
          #
          # @param [Hash{Symbol => Object}] ssl
          #   Additional keyword arguments for
          #   `Ronin::Support::Network::SSL.connect`.
          #
          # @param [Hash{Symbol => Object}] kwargs
          #   Additional keyword arguments for {Client#initialize}.
          #
          # @!macro client_kwargs
          #
          # @return [Boolean, nil]
          #   Specifies whether the WebSocket is open.
          #   If the connection was not accepted, `nil` will be returned.
          #
          # @api public
          #
          # @see WebSocket.open?
          #
          def websocket_open?(url, ssl: {}, **kwargs)
            WebSocket.open?(url, ssl: ssl, **kwargs)
          end

          #
          # Connects to a websocket.
          #
          # @param [String, URI::WS, URI::WSS] url
          #   The `ws://` or `wss://` URL to connect to.
          #
          # @param [Hash{Symbol => Object}] ssl
          #   Additional keyword arguments for
          #   `Ronin::Support::Network::SSL.connect`.
          #
          # @param [Hash{Symbol => Object}] kwargs
          #   Additional keyword arguments for {Client#initialize}.
          #
          # @!macro client_kwargs
          #
          # @yield [websocket]
          #   If a block is given, then it will be passed the WebSocket
          #   connection. Once the block has returned, the WebSocket connection
          #   will be closed.
          #
          # @yieldparam [Client] websocket
          #   The WebSocket connection.
          #
          # @return [Client]
          #   The WebSocket connection.
          #
          # @example Connecting to a WebSocket server:
          #   websocket_connect('ws://websocket-echo.com')
          #   # => #<Ronin::Support::Web::WebSocket::Client: ...>
          #
          # @example Creating a temporary WebSocket connection:
          #   websocket_connect('ws://websocket-echo.com') do |websocket|
          #     # ...
          #   end
          #
          # @api public
          #
          # @see WebSocket.connect
          #
          def websocket_connect(url, ssl: {}, **kwargs, &block)
            WebSocket.connect(url, ssl: ssl, **kwargs, &block)
          end
